About the Department of Child Services:
Join a group of passionate, dedicated public servants to support one of Indiana’s most critical missions!
The Department of Child Services helps children who are victims of abuse or neglect and strengthens families through services that focus on family support and preservation. We pursue permanency for children and families through reunification, guardianship, and adoption. Our services also encompass foster care, child support, and transitional support for those adjusting to adulthood. Our culture is built upon our MVP foundation:

Role Overview :
The Institutional Investigator assesses allegations of child abuse and neglect in facilities such as schools, residential treatment facilities, daycare centers, and detention centers. You may occasionally travel to other counties when needed. Mileage is reimbursed if using a personal vehicle.
This position requires higher than average travel to complete investigations.
Please click this link for a realistic job preview video.
This position works primarily from Indianapolis, Indiana, and will serve Central Indiana counties. Residency in the service area is preferred.
Salary :
The salary for this position traditionally starts at $47,320.00 but may be commensurate with education or work experience.
